Output 103d9915baaf00aded67d971aa54e4ed36b02b789ef6f28d7f98340c87a39b6c:1

value
7556266
script pubkey
OP_HASH160 OP_PUSHBYTES_20 059117f7106755087d1cab50424ddc30bd6d3c52 OP_EQUAL
address
32CT7nRMeg2fAeuVq6DSjbJi6UMRxvQfrt
transaction
103d9915baaf00aded67d971aa54e4ed36b02b789ef6f28d7f98340c87a39b6c
spent
true